file-type

Vue.js打造新版URL Monster-crx插件功能解析

ZIP文件

86KB | 更新于2024-12-09 | 24 浏览量 | 0 下载量 举报 收藏
download 立即下载
其主要功能包括将当前URL的不同部分(如协议、主机、端口、路径、查询和片段)拆分为单独的组件,并允许用户对这些组件进行创建、编辑、删除、解码、编码和复制等操作。此外,该插件支持重建完整的URL,并可应用于当前标签页或新标签页。版本迭代记录显示,最新版本2.1.0修复了查询键入问题,版本2.0.0标志着完全使用Vue.js技术的重制,而早期版本包括为移动设备优化的元数据添加等改进。" 详细知识点: 1. Vue.js框架应用: Vue.js是一个构建用户界面的渐进式框架。该插件的开发人员选择使用Vue.js重制URL Monster,因为Vue.js以其易用性、灵活性和高效的性能而受到开发者的青睐。Vue.js支持数据驱动的视图更新和组件化的开发模式,使其非常适合处理URL Monster这样的工具,其功能需要频繁地与用户界面交互和数据同步。 2. 浏览器扩展程序开发: URL Monster是一个浏览器扩展程序,它通过浏览器提供的API与用户的浏览行为交互。扩展程序通常包含HTML、CSS和JavaScript等资源文件,并且可以通过特定的manifest.json文件配置扩展的权限、功能和用户界面。 3. URL组件化处理: URL Monster插件的核心功能之一是对URL的组成部分进行分别处理。URL可以被分为不同的组件,包括协议(scheme)、主机(host)、端口(port)、路径(path)、查询(query)和片段(fragment)。每个组件都包含了不同的信息,扩展程序通过解析和重建这些组件,帮助用户更好地理解和编辑URL。 4. URL编辑功能: 插件提供的编辑功能包括: - 创建新组件:允许用户添加新的URL组件,如新增查询参数。 - 编辑现有组件:修改URL各部分的信息。 - 删除组件:从URL中移除不需要的部分。 - 解码组件:将URL编码部分转换为人类可读的格式。 - 编码组件:将人类可读的组件转换为URL兼容的编码格式。 - 复制组件:将URL组件复制到剪贴板,方便用户在其他地方使用。 5. URL重建和应用: 用户编辑完URL的各个组件后,可以使用插件提供的重建功能来生成完整的URL。用户可以选择将重建的URL在当前标签页中应用,或在新的标签页中打开。这对于测试URL、进行快速导航或调试等场景非常有用。 6. 版本更新与改进: 插件的版本更新记录显示了软件开发的迭代过程和持续改进。例如: - 版本2.1.0修正了查询参数键入时可能出现的问题,提升了用户体验。 - 版本2.0.0标志着插件从头开始使用Vue.js技术进行重制,这可能意味着性能提升、代码重构和新特性的加入。 - 版本1.1中增加了对移动设备视口元标签的支持,这表明开发者关注了在不同设备上的兼容性和表现。 7. 动态扩展与标签页管理: 插件能够在当前标签页或新标签页中应用变更,这意味着它能够管理用户的浏览标签页,并在用户进行URL编辑时提供灵活的操作选项。 URL Monster-crx插件展示了一个现代浏览器扩展程序可以如何利用前端框架来提升用户体验,并处理复杂的用户交互场景。通过不断更新和优化,该插件已经成为了一个功能丰富、操作简便的URL编辑工具。

相关推荐

weixin_38701312
  • 粉丝: 8
上传资源 快速赚钱